“Since the movie Pi is a sci-fi psychological conspiracy thriller, the soundtrack itself sounds futuristic, and contains a wide variety of electronic-dance stars alongside three originals by composer Clint Mansell (formerly of Pop Will Eat Itself). Massive Attack's haunting "Angel" is easily the soundtrack's highlight — distorted guitar, ethereal bass, and crisp percussion creep along for six minutes, with Horace Andy supplying the vocals. Also included is the drum duel "Bucephalus Bouncing Ball" by Aphex Twin, the rapid-fire Roni Size dance track "Watching Windows," and the imaginative "Drippy" by Banco de Gaia (dripping water and percussion become merged together). Other contributors include Orbital ("P.E.T.R.O.L."), Gus Gus ("Anthem"), and Spacetime Continuum ("A Low Frequency Inversion Field"), among others.”
